Two-Year checkup: can simple ligament tightening stop leaks?

NCT ID NCT07384117

Summary

This study follows 200 adults for two years after surgery to fix urinary incontinence. Surgeons tighten specific ligaments to help control bladder leaks during activities like coughing (stress incontinence) or sudden urges (urge incontinence). The main goal is to see how well the surgeries work long-term and to record any complications.
